The hospital application segment represents a significant share of the overweight-patient recliner market, as healthcare facilities are increasingly investing in specialized furniture to meet the needs of overweight and obese patients. Hospitals require recliners that are durable, easy to clean, and capable of supporting patients' weight without compromising safety or comfort. Overweight-patient recliners designed for hospitals are equipped with features such as reinforced frames, high weight capacities, and adjustable settings to accommodate medical treatments and procedures. These recliners are particularly beneficial for patients who need to spend extended periods sitting or reclining due to medical conditions such as post-surgical recovery, cardiovascular diseases, or obesity-related complications.The growth of the hospital segment is influenced by the rising number of obesity-related health issues and surgeries, driving demand for recliners that can provide optimal comfort and support. Hospitals are also prioritizing patient experience, leading to investments in recliners that improve comfort during long stays.
